The Ducati Monster 696 is a masterclass in design and engineering. A potent four-stroke, 90-degree twin-cylinder engine lies at its heart, delivering the trademark Ducati L-Twin power and flexibility.

Its slender waistline and wide handlebars create an unparalleled riding experience, balancing performance with everyday usability. This is a bike that’s just as comfortable carving through city streets as it is on the open road.

The Monster 696’s chassis technology is sport-derived, honed to perfection by Ducati’s engineers. Every finely engineered element of the chassis and engine is on display, exuding a sense of raw beauty and unbridled power.

Riding the Monster 696 is more than just getting from point A to B – it’s an experience that immerses you in the thrill of naked power. With its low seat height and intuitive ergonomics, every rider will feel confident and in control.

The result is a bike that’s not only breathtakingly stylish but also remarkably light, tipping the scales at just 161kg (dry weight). Ducati Monster 696 (2014)

All Specifications

Make & Model

ModelDucati Monster 696
Year2014

Engine

Engine TypeFour stroke, 90Ltwin cylinder, SOHC, 2 desmodromic valves per cylinder
Displacement42.4 cubic inches / 696 cc
Bore x Stroke88 x 57.2 mm
Compression Ratio10.7:1
Max Horsepower58.8 kw / 78.8 hp
Max Torque69 Nm / 7.0kgf-m / 50.9 ft-lb@ 7750 rpm
Engine Management SystemMarelliInjection. Siemens electronic fuel injection, 45mm throttle body
Cooling SystemAir cooled
ExhaustLightweight 2-1-2 system with catalytic converter with twin lambda probes

Performance

Top Speed210 km/h / 130mph

Transmission

ClutchAPTC wet multiplate with hydraulic control
Gearbox6 Speed
Gear Ratios1st 32/13, 2nd 30/18, 3rd 28/21, 4th 26/23, 5th 22/22, 6th 24/26
Final DriveChain; front sprocket 15; rear sprocket 39

Electrical & Electronics System

StarterElectric

Chassis & Suspension

Frame TypeTubularsteeltrellisframe
Front SuspensionProgressivelinkagewithpreloadandreboundadjustableSachsmonoshock
Rear Suspension Travel5.8 inches / 148 mm
Rake24
Trail87mm / 3.42 in

Wheels & Brakes

Wheels3-spoke light alloy
Front Tire Size120/60 ZR17
Rear Tire Size160/60 ZR17
Front Brakes2x 320 mm Discs, 4 piston calipers
Rear BrakesSingle 245mm disc, 2 piston caliper

Dimension & Weights

Seat Height30.3 inches / 770 mm
Wheelbase57.1 inches / 1450 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ity3.8 US gallons / 15.0 L
Dry Weight161 kg / 355 lbs
